ANXA2, His, Mouse

ANXA2, highly expressed in invasive breast cancer cells, is closely related with poor prognosis, and acts as a molecular switch to EGFR activation. ANXA2 expression is inversely correlated with cell sensitivity to gefitinib. Knockdown of ANXA2 expression in MDA-MB-231 cells increased the gefitinib induced cell death. When ANXA2 was overexpressed in MCF7 cells, the gefitinib induced cell death was decreased. Furthermore, the phosphorylation of ANXA2 at Tyr23 is negatively correlated with the sensitivity of TNBC to gefitinib.

Species Mouse
Protein Construction
His ANXA2 (Ser2-Asp339)_x000D_
Accession # P07356
N-term C-term
Purity > 95% as determined by Bis-Tris PAGE
Endotoxin Level Less than 1EU per μg by the LAL method.
Expression System E.coli
Theoretical Molecular Weight 39.6 kDa
Apparent Molecular Weight The protein has a predicted MW of 39.6 kDa same as Bis-Tris PAGE result.
Formulation Lyophilized from 0.22μm filtered solution in 20mM MES, 150mM NaCl, 200mM L-arginine, 5mM DTT (pH 5.5).
Reconstitution Centrifuge the tube before opening. Reconstituting to a concentration more than 100 μg/ml is recommended. Dissolve the lyophilized protein in 20mM MES, 150mM NaCl, 200mM L-arginine, 5mM DTT (pH 5.5).
Storage & Stability Upon receiving, the product remains stable up to 6 months at -20 °C or below. Upon reconstitution, the product should be stable for 3 months at -80 °C. Avoid repeated freeze-thaw cycles.
